The landscaping makes all the difference in the external areas, so the garden decoration with stones has become a well used device in the field. Before starting your garden project, check out the types of stones you most identify to compose in your green space.
The river stone is a model of earthy tone ranging from beige to brown and is the right choice for those who prefer a more natural style garden. The crushed stone is the most traditional. The white color is ideal to highlight the green of the plants, creating the impression of a more clean . Another option is the dolomite stone in the same color. And, finally, the natural pebble with light tonality has favorable characteristics to like a garden connected to the trees and many plants to its surroundings.
The use of the stones depends on the size of the garden and how you will mount it. In a winter garden, for example, try to increase with decorative pots and plants that suit the indoor environment. Already for a yard, use to intercalate the lining of stones with boards of concrete or wood. And, if you'd rather dare, install a water mirror and increment with stones to create a garden Zen for relaxing moments inside your home.
